aharon Posted June 22, 2015 Share Posted June 22, 2015 Shalom and greetings all my pals, Presenting recreation of Israeli air force's emergency KC-97 cargo resupply mission from an Israeli air force base to HE1F Fayid air force base in Egypt located approximately 23 km south of Ismailia and 69 miles northeast of Cairo during Yom Kippur war. Yes you are reading it correctly!!! It marked the first time in history of Israel that Israeli air force plane had landed on Egyptian air force base!!! How did it happen? Israeli army forces with tanks managed to smash through Egyptian defenses, crossed Suez Canal, and landed on Egypt pushing 30 miles deep inside Egypt which created one logistical problem which was replenishment of supplies such as food, fuel, ammunition, and spare parts. Since it would take too long time for supply trucks to travel from Israel to deep inside Egypt, they decided to use cargo planes to fly all supplies from Israel to HE1F Fayid air force base that was captured by Israeli army.
